55e3d9224b60df0fd2dc36bff9b538ce40fd9586 10-Mar-2007 Andres Salomon <dilinger@debian.org> Input: psmouse - allow disabing certain protocol extensions

Allow ALPS, LOGIPS2PP, LIFEBOOK, TRACKPOINT and TOUCHKIT protocol
extensions of psmouse to be disabled during compilation. This will
allow users save some memory when they are sure that they will only
use a certain type of mice.
